What is International Stout Day?

International Stout Day is an annual celebration that pays homage to the dark beer style known as stout, with its roasted malt and coffee-like notes.

Stout has roots dating back to the 18th century, originating from the Porter in London. Ireland continued experimenting with the beer style which later launched beers like Guinness and expanded globally. 

Today, we have lots of different types of stouts, one being our Milk Stout, where we add lactose to the beer to add a delicate sweetness and sumptuous character. We use a selection of dark malts for layers of roast and dark chocolate. Wakatu and Goldings hops supply hints of floral and vanilla to complete a well-rounded dark beer.
